What Medication is Used for Inflammation of the Veins?

4 min read
According to Medscape, nonsteroidal anti-inflammatory drugs (NSAIDs) are a primary treatment option for mild to moderate superficial thrombophlebitis. However, the specific **medication used for inflammation of the veins** depends heavily on whether the condition is superficial or deep, and if a blood clot is present.
